Blockchain in Insurance — Security and Transparency

The insurance industry thrives on trust and security, and blockchain serves as the perfect ally. It ensures the integrity and transparency of data. With blockchain, policy information, claims, and premiums can be easily verified and authenticated. This reduces the potential for fraud and makes claims processing faster and more efficient. Clients can rest assured that their policies are accurate, and claims will be swiftly settled.

Blockchain in Banking — Swift and Secure Transactions

Banks are the pillars of the global economy, but they’re also prime targets for constant cyber threats. Blockchain provides impenetrable protection against hackers, ensuring transactions are safe and efficient. Instead of traditional systems that require time for transaction confirmation, blockchain allows for near-instantaneous transactions. This not only saves time but also reduces costs and the risk of errors. Furthermore, blockchain empowers banks to enhance their services and develop innovative products.

Blockchain in Logistics — Connecting the World

Logistics is a complex industry that demands flawless management and tracking. Blockchain offers a digital ledger of all transactions and events in the supply chain, making it easier to trace the journey of goods from start to finish. This reduces losses and enhances transportation efficiency. Smart contracts enable the automation of deliveries and payments, making logistics more efficient and reliable.

Blockchain in the Pharmaceutical Industry — Combating Counterfeits

The pharmaceutical industry faces serious challenges in combating counterfeit and fake drugs. Blockchain brings hope by enabling the verification of drug authenticity throughout the supply chain. Customers can be confident that the medicines they take are genuine and safe, while pharmaceutical companies can better track the movement of their products.

Blockchain in the Music Industry — Fair Distribution

The music industry grapples with issues related to fair revenue distribution among artists, producers, and stakeholders. Blockchain offers transparency regarding streaming and music sales revenue. With smart contracts, revenue can be automatically distributed based on pre-defined terms, ensuring a fair and equitable reward for every artist.
